Output 9780f8b3ccf6638cea0ca27aebede2519591213950dceb0cae6ae1edab240a36:21

value
54091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a40f4683f3db8e7d0d64afda52bb16e31e6627 OP_EQUAL
address
3QMi3BbBCosu1qPNuCBeHjvm7b9XcMxeGy
transaction
9780f8b3ccf6638cea0ca27aebede2519591213950dceb0cae6ae1edab240a36
confirmations
267671
spent
true